**The Landscape: Rural Healthcare Considerations**
The healthcare landscape in rural areas like Sidney, NY, presents unique challenges. Access to specialized care can be limited, and travel distances to larger medical centers often become a factor. This review acknowledges these realities, prioritizing proximity and accessibility while evaluating the quality of care available.

**Delaware Valley Hospital (Walton, NY): A Community Anchor**
Delaware Valley Hospital (DVH) is a critical access hospital located in Walton, approximately 20 minutes from Sidney. As a critical access hospital, DVH is designed to provide essential services to a rural population. The hospital's focus is on providing a range of core services, including emergency care, inpatient care, and outpatient services. DVH is a vital resource for the community.
**CMS Star Rating:** DVH does not have a CMS star rating. CMS star ratings are not provided for critical access hospitals.
**Emergency Room (ER) Performance:** ER wait times at DVH are generally shorter than at larger, urban hospitals. Data on precise wait times is not readily available, but anecdotal evidence suggests reasonable wait times.
**Specialty Services:** DVH offers a variety of services including general surgery, orthopedics, cardiology, and rehabilitation. DVH has a laboratory and imaging services. DVH has a robust primary care network.
**Telehealth:** DVH has been expanding its telehealth offerings, particularly in areas like behavioral health and specialist consultations. This is crucial for rural communities.
**Overall Health Score (Delaware Valley Hospital):** Considering its critical access status and role in the community, DVH receives a solid score. It provides essential services and is a crucial resource for the area. Its focus on telehealth is a positive sign of adapting to the needs of the community.
**Bassett Medical Center (Cooperstown, NY): A Regional Hub**
Bassett Medical Center, located in Cooperstown (approximately 45 minutes from Sidney), is a larger, more comprehensive hospital. It serves as a regional referral center, offering a wider array of specialized services.
**CMS Star Rating:** Bassett Medical Center has a 3-star rating from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). This rating reflects the hospital's overall quality, including patient outcomes, safety, and patient experience.
**Emergency Room (ER) Performance:** ER wait times at Bassett Medical Center are generally longer than at DVH, reflecting the higher patient volume and complexity of cases. Specific wait times vary depending on the time of day and the severity of the patient's condition.
**Specialty Services:** Bassett Medical Center boasts a comprehensive range of specialty services, including cardiology, oncology, neurology, and a renowned orthopedic program. The hospital has a dedicated heart center, cancer institute, and a robust surgical program.
**Telehealth:** Bassett Medical Center has a well-developed telehealth program. Telehealth services are available for various specialties, including primary care, behavioral health, and specialist consultations. This is a key advantage for patients in the region.
**Overall Health Score (Bassett Medical Center):** Bassett Medical Center receives a higher overall score than DVH due to its broader range of services, higher CMS star rating, and more developed specialty programs. However, patients should be prepared for potentially longer ER wait times.

**Assessing Key Metrics: A Deeper Dive**
**Emergency Room Wait Times: A Critical Factor**
ER wait times are a crucial indicator of a hospital's efficiency and ability to handle patient volume. While precise data is not always readily available, patients should inquire about average wait times when choosing a hospital.
**Patient Satisfaction: The Human Element**
Patient satisfaction surveys, such as those conducted by CMS, provide valuable insights into the patient experience. These surveys assess factors like communication with doctors and nurses, responsiveness of staff, and the overall hospital environment.
**Specialty Services: Meeting Specific Needs**
The availability of specialized services is crucial for patients with complex medical conditions. Hospitals with comprehensive specialty programs can provide a higher level of care.
**Telehealth: Bridging the Distance**
Telehealth is particularly important in rural areas. It allows patients to access healthcare services remotely, reducing the need for travel and improving access to specialists.
**Financial Considerations: Navigating Costs**
Healthcare costs can be a significant burden. Patients should inquire about the hospital's billing practices, insurance coverage, and financial assistance programs.
